Hoover (Herbert) Middle is a State/Public serving middle age pupils, located in San Francisco, San Francisco County. The school has 938 pupils enrolled. The Principal is Adrienne Smith. It is part of the San Francisco Unified school district. It serves grades 6โ8 in an urban setting. The school employs 40.6 full-time-equivalent teachers, a student-teacher ratio of 23.1:1.
Hoover (Herbert) Middle enrolls 938 students across grades 6โ8. The student body is 52% male and 48% female. A teaching staff of 40.6 full-time-equivalent teachers supports the school, giving a student-teacher ratio of 23.1:1.
By race and ethnicity, the student body is 53% Asian, 30% Hispanic or Latino and 7.5% Two or more races.
| Race / ethnicity | Students | Share |
|---|---|---|
| Asian | 495 | 53% |
| Hispanic or Latino | 285 | 30% |
| Two or more races | 70 | 7.5% |
| White | 61 | 6.5% |
| Black or African American | 23 | 2.5% |
|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ander | 3 | <1% |
| American Indian or Alaska Native | 1 | <1% |
Source: NCES Common Core of Data.
562 of the school's 938 students (60%) q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. Free and reduced-price lunch eligibility is a widely used indicator of the share of students from lower-income households.
Hoover (Herbert) Middle is located in an urban setting (NCES locale: City, Large). The school runs a schoolwide Title I program, which provides federal funding to support students from low-income families.
Hoover (Herbert) Middle is one of 113 schools in San Francisco Unified, based in San Francisco, California. The district serves 48,902 students district-wide and employs 2,316 full-time-equivalent teachers. With 938 students, Hoover (Herbert) Middle is larger than the district average of about 433 students per school.
